Abstract

Studyng special native and foreign literatues on the problem of the forms of existing language shows that opinion of many scientists are not similiar toeach others and non-adequate. Because of this we can have 3 main directions. Presenters of the fist direction describe two , three, four forms of existing national language. Scientists, uho refer to the second social-linguistic schools, emphasize four forms of existing languages, such as: literatural language, simple speech, social dialects and territorial dialects. The third social-linguistic school assents the attention on the main and mid-term forms of existing national language. In German language three forms of existing language are pointed in scientific literature: German literatural language, casual-speech form of language , local dialects.
